Rats in particular can be VERY prone to cancer, malignant or benign. It is usually in the salivary glands or mammary tumors, but can turn into an all out lymphatic cancer. Not fun. Also, inbreeding can be a cause for growths or other abnormalities, so use the same pairs, or one dad for the same mom rodents and no breeding moms to sons or dads to daughters, LoL ... And yes, as Smulkin said, there can be cannibalization of the babies if stress is involved, so try to keep the cage(s) as quiet as possible. Also, if you're pretty money-conscious, you really don't have to disinfect the cage with anything special, just soap and water works, or a little bleach, just be sure to rinse REALLY well.
